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

lalf.session.UnableToConnect: Impossible de se connecter. Vérifiez les identifiants de l'administrateur #79

Open
jeffhpc opened this issue Sep 3, 2022 · 2 comments

Comments

@jeffhpc
Copy link

jeffhpc commented Sep 3, 2022

debug.log

Bonjour à tous
Suite au problème #77 corrigé (merci encore), j'ai relancé le script, qui cette fois commence bien son déroulé.

Sauvegarde ok des émoticones,
récupération des membre (2874)
INFO : Récupération des groupes
INFO : Récupération des forums
INFO : Récupération du forum f46
DEBUG : Récupération du forum f46 (page 0)
INFO : Récupération du sujet 9073
INFO : Récupération du message 103461 (sujet 7684)
INFO : Récupération du message 103480 (sujet 7684)
INFO : Récupération du sujet 1276
DEBUG : Récupération des messages du sujet 1276 (page 0)
INFO : Récupération du message 11322 (sujet 1276)
INFO : Récupération du sujet 1109
DEBUG : Récupération des messages du sujet 1109 (page 0)
DEBUG : Connection au forum
DEBUG : Récupération du sid
DEBUG : Récupération du tid
INFO : La connexion a échoué au moins deux fois, attend 30 secondes avant de réessayer.
DEBUG : Connection au forum
DEBUG : Récupération du sid
DEBUG : Récupération du tid
INFO : La connexion a échoué au moins deux fois, attend 30 secondes avant de réessayer.

debug log :
La connexion a échoué au moins deux fois, attend 30 secondes avant de réessayer.
La connexion a échoué au moins deux fois, attend 30 secondes avant de réessayer.
La connexion a échoué au moins deux fois, attend 30 secondes avant de réessayer.
Sauvegarde de l'état courant.
ERROR : Une erreur est survenue. Essayez de relancer le script. Si vous rencontrez la même erreur (UnableToConnect()), créez un rapport de bug à l'adresse suivante SI ELLE N'A PAS ENCORE ÉTÉ SIGNALÉE :
https://github.com/Roromis/Lalf-Forumactif/issues
Traceback (most recent call last):
File "/root/.local/lib/python3.8/site-packages/lalf/init.py", line 58, in main
bb.export()
File "/root/.local/lib/python3.8/site-packages/lalf/node.py", line 116, in export
child.export()
File "/root/.local/lib/python3.8/site-packages/lalf/node.py", line 116, in export
child.export()
File "/root/.local/lib/python3.8/site-packages/lalf/node.py", line 116, in export
child.export()
[Previous line repeated 2 more times]
File "/root/.local/lib/python3.8/site-packages/lalf/node.py", line 112, in export
self.export()
File "/root/.local/lib/python3.8/site-packages/lalf/posts.py", line 97, in export
response = self.session.get("/t{}p{}-a".format(self.topic.topic_id, self.page))
File "/root/.local/lib/python3.8/site-packages/lalf/session.py", line 143, in get
raise UnableToConnect()
lalf.session.UnableToConnect: Impossible de se connecter. Vérifiez les identifiants de l'administrateur

---> vérifiés et ok, script relancé plusieurs fois, erreur identique dès le début à présent.

je suis allé dans chaque fichier .py aux lignes indiquées pour essayer de comprendre le souci, sans succès.

Une idée ? : / merci d'avance.

@jeffhpc
Copy link
Author

jeffhpc commented Sep 3, 2022

je viens de voir ce sujet #52

j'ai donc supprimé le save.pickle, le script reprend, deroule une partie puis :

...
Récupération du membre 2874
Récupération des groupes
Récupération des forums
Récupération du forum f46
Récupération du sujet 9073
La connexion a échoué au moins deux fois, attend 30 secondes avant de réessayer.
La connexion a échoué au moins deux fois, attend 30 secondes avant de réessayer.
La connexion a échoué au moins deux fois, attend 30 secondes avant de réessayer.
Sauvegarde de l'état courant.
ERROR : Une erreur est survenue. Essayez de relancer le script. Si vous rencontrez la même erreur (UnableToConnect()), créez un rapport de bug à l'adresse suivante SI ELLE N'A PAS ENCORE ÉTÉ SIGNALÉE :
https://github.com/Roromis/Lalf-Forumactif/issues
Traceback (most recent call last):
File "/root/.local/lib/python3.8/site-packages/lalf/init.py", line 58, in main
bb.export()
File "/root/.local/lib/python3.8/site-packages/lalf/node.py", line 116, in export
child.export()
File "/root/.local/lib/python3.8/site-packages/lalf/node.py", line 116, in export
child.export()
File "/root/.local/lib/python3.8/site-packages/lalf/node.py", line 116, in export
child.export()
[Previous line repeated 1 more time]
File "/root/.local/lib/python3.8/site-packages/lalf/node.py", line 112, in export
self.export()
File "/root/.local/lib/python3.8/site-packages/lalf/topics.py", line 64, in export
response = self.session.get("/t{}-a".format(self.topic_id))
File "/root/.local/lib/python3.8/site-packages/lalf/session.py", line 143, in get
raise UnableToConnect()
lalf.session.UnableToConnect: Impossible de se connecter. Vérifiez les identifiants de l'administrateur

@kepon85
Copy link

kepon85 commented Sep 3, 2022

T'as bien le bon thème comme dans la doc ?

Depuis la doc, le script forum actif à ajouter plein de truc "anti-spam" (ou anti-aspiration... ) du coup je suggère de "ralentir" la récupération pour ne pas passer pour un spammeur.

Moi je ne supprimerai pas le save.pickle ça permet de repartir de là où tu plante.

Dans posts.py, ligne 21 :

import re

Tu peux ajouter import time

Puis dans le script tu peux ajouter des "sleep" pour ralentir la récupération
: time.sleep(30)

Exemple avant la ligne 65

self.logger.debug("Exportation du message %d (sujet %d)", self.post_id, self.topic.topic_id)

ligne 107 :
self.logger.info('Récupération du message %d (sujet %d)',

Si ça bloque met plus que 30, ou patiente 24h... bref faut tâtonner...

Perso j'ai rencontré des difficultés sur la récupération des boîtes e-mail, à un moment mon forum cache toutes les e-mail, il se met en sécurité... Et même si je change d'IP ou quoi, rien n'y fait... faut que je patiente 24h avant que ça revienne...

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ants